  • System account manager

    cryptography, operating system, security (SAM) A password database stored as a registry file in Windows NT and Windows 2000. The System Account Manager (SAM) database stores users’ passwords in a hashed format. Since a hash function is one-way, this provides some measure of security for the storage of the passwords.
